PostCSS Cachebuster Build Status npm version

PostCSS plugin added cachebuster to local files based on their datechanged.

Input css example

@import url("/css/styles.css");
.foo {
  background-image : url('../images/index/logo.png');
  behavior : url('../behaviors/backgroundsize.min.htc');
}
@font-face {
  font-family: 'My font';
  src: url('fonts/myfont.ttf');
}

Output css example

@import url("/css/styles.css?v66f22a33fff");
.foo {
  background-image : url('../images/index/logo.png?v14f32a475b8')
  behavior : url('../behaviors/backgroundsize.min.htc?v15f55a666c2');
}
@font-face {
  font-family: 'My font';
  src: url('fonts/myfont.ttf?v32f14a88dcf');
}

Configure

postcss([ 
  require('postcss-cachebuster')({
    imagesPath : '/images', 
    cssPath : '/stylesheets'
  }) 
])

See PostCSS docs for examples for your environment.

Options

  • cssPath - option to redefine relative images resolving directory (by default the same as css file folder)
  • imagesPath - variable to define absolute images base path
  • type - define cachebuster type, mtime by default, allows: mtime, checksum (checksum based on md5), or a function which receives the absolute path to the file as an argument and whose return value becomes the url pathname.
